ex. The Libra Hotel
#11/1, Near Christ College, Hosur Main Road, Bengaluru, Karnataka, Bangalore, India
#11/1, Near Christ College, Hosur Main Road, Bengaluru, Karnataka, Bangalore, India
Hotel Reservation System | 2026 © in-karnataka.com. All rights reserved
Contacts